'Is this India B team?': Netizens react after USA announce women's squad for historic U-19 T20 World Cup
The women’s T20 event is scheduled from January 14-29 in South Africa

A cricket team with players named Geetika Kodali, Anika Kolan, Aditi Chudasama and Bhumika Bhadriraju… might suggest it is an Indian outfit.
Surprisingly, these are players of the USA cricket team that will participate in the inaugural ICC U-19 Women’s T20 World Cup in South Africa next month.
USA Cricket announced a 15-player squad that will represent the United States of America in the women’s T20 event is scheduled from January 14-29.
Surprisingly, most of the players representing the USA team are of Indian origin.
The squad is captained by Geetika Kodali while the coaching team is led by West Indies batting great Shivnarine Chanderpaul.
The USA face a challenging Group A that features Australia, Bangladesh, and Sri Lanka.

This ICC U-19 Women’s T20 World Cup is the first edition of what will be a biennial World Cup for the best young female cricketers around the world.
Eleven ICC Full-Member nations gained automatic entry to the event: Australia, Bangladesh, England, India, Ireland, New Zealand, Pakistan, South Africa, Sri Lanka, West Indies and Zimbabwe.
The remaining five spots were filled by one team from each of the ICC’s five regions.
Team USA Women’s U-19 Squad
Geetika Kodali (C), Anika Kolan (wk), Aditi Chudasama, Bhumika Bhadriraju, Disha Dhingra, Isani Vaghela, Jivana Aras, Laasya Mullapudi, Pooja Ganesh (wk) Pooja Shah, Ritu Singh, Sai Tanmayi Eyyunni, Snigdha Paul, Suhani Thadani, Taranum Chopra
Reserves: Chetnaa Prasad, Kasturi Vedantham, Lisa Ramjit, Mitali Patwardhan, Tya Gonsalves
Head Coach: Shivnarine Chanderpaul
